/* 　リンネ用のCSSファイルです。(＠_＠)/　　 */

/*　階層表記に使って下さい　*/
.kaisou{
	font-size: 9px;
	font-style: normal;
	color: #676767;
	padding: 5px
}
.kaisou_a{
	font-size: 9px;
	font-style: normal;
	color: #666666;
	padding: 5px;
	text-decoration:none
}
.kaisou_a:hover{
	font-size: 9px;
	font-style: normal;
	color: #FFCC33;
	padding: 5px;
	text-decoration:none
}

/*　テキストリンク　*/

.link12px_a{
	font-size: 12px;
	font-style: normal;
	color: #666666;
	padding: 5px;
	text-decoration:none;
	font-weight: normal
}

.link12px_a:hover{
	font-size: 12px;
	font-style: normal;
	color: #FFCC33;
	padding: 5px;
	text-decoration:none;
	font-weight: normal
}

.link12px_02_a{
	font-size: 12px;
	font-style: normal;
	color: #FF8400;
	padding: 5px;
	text-decoration:underline;
	font-weight: normal;
}

.link12px_02_a:hover{
	font-size: 12px;
	font-style: normal;
	color: #FFCC33;
	padding: 5px;
	text-decoration:underline;
	font-weight: normal;
}

/*　フッダー用　*/
.fd{
text-align: center;
font-weight: normal;
boder: solid #000000;
color: #FFFFFF;
background: #ff9933;
border-left-width: 100px;
border-right-width: 100px
}
.fd10{
font-size: 10px;
text-align: center;
font-weight: normal;
color: #FFFFFF;
}

/*　サイトマップ用のCSSなのだ　*/
.px12_site_org{
	font-size: 12px;
	font-style: normal;
	color: #FF9900;
	font-weight: normal
}

.px12_sitemap_a{
	font-size: 12px;
	font-style: normal;
	color: #666666;
	font-weight: normal;
    text-decoration:none;
　　vertical-align:middle
}
.px12_sitemap_a:hover{
	font-size: 12px;
	font-style: normal;
	color: #FF0000;
	text-decoration:none;
	font-weight: normal;
	vertical-align:middle
}
vertical-align:middle
}
.mark_site{
    vertical-align:top;
    padding: 5px
}	

/*　会社概要用のCSSだ　*/
.hr_dt {
  color: #ff9933; /* 線の色(IE用) */
  height: 1.5px; /* 線の太さ */
  border-style :dotted ;
  padding-top: 5px; 
  padding-bottom: 5px
  } 
.hr_nm {
  color: #000000; /* 線の色(IE用) */
  height: 1px; /* 線の太さ */
  border: 1px; /* 枠の太さ */
  border-style :solid 
  } 

.12px_left{
	font-size: 12px;
	font-style: normal;
	color: #666666;
	padding-top: 5px;
	padding-bottom: 5px;
	text-decoration:none;
	font-weight: normal
	line-height: 1.5em;
}
.12px_right{
	font-size: 12px;
	font-style: normal;
	color: #333333;
	padding-top: 5px; 
	padding-bottom: 5px;
	text-decoration:none;
	font-weight: normal;
	position: absolute;
	left: 300px;
	width: 345px;
	height: 39px
	}
.12px_snt{
	font-size: 12px;
	font-style: normal;
	color: #333333;
	padding-top: 5px; 
	padding-bottom: 5px;
	text-decoration:none;
	font-weight: normal
	}
	
/*　個人情報用のCSSだ　*/
.px14_bold{
	font-size: 14px;
	font-style: normal;
	color: #262626;
	font-weight: normal
}	
.px12_bold{
	font-size: 12px;
	font-style: normal;
	color: #262626;
	font-weight: normal
}
.px12_gray_bold{
	font-size: 12px;
	font-style: normal;
	color: #333333;
	font-weight: normal
}
.px12_gray{
	font-size: 12px;
	font-style: normal;
	color: #333333;
	font-weight: normal
}
.px12_blue{
	font-size: 12px;
	font-style: normal;
	color: #0000FF;
	font-weight: normal
}
.px12_brde{
	font-size: 12px;
	font-style: normal;
	color: #FF3300;
	font-weight: normal
}

.p_pri{
font-size: 12px;
font-style: normal;
color: #666666;
font-weight: normal;
padding-left: 15px;
padding-right: 15px;
line-height: 1.5em;
}	

.p2{
font-size: 12px;
font-style: normal;
color: #666666;
font-weight: normal;
padding-left: 15px;
padding-right: 15px;
}	

.hr_pri {
  color: #77c700; /* 線の色(IE用) */
 height: 1px; /* 線の太さ */
  border: 1px; /* 枠の太さ */
  border-style :dotted　
} 

/*　ショッピングガイド用のCSSなのね　*/
.px12_bold_komidashi{
	font-size: 12px;
	font-style: normal;
	color: #000000;
	font-weight: normal;
    border-top:solid 2px #FFCC33;
	border-bottom:solid 2px #FFCC33;
	border-right:solid 2px #FFCC33;
	border-left:solid 2px #FFCC33;
	padding-left : 15px;
	padding-right: 15px;
	padding-top : 1px;
	padding-bottom: 1px
	}
.px10_bold{
	font-size: 10px;
	font-style: normal;
	color: #555555;
	font-weight: normal;
	margin-top: 5px;
	margin-bottom: 5px;
    line-height:1.5em;
	}

.px10_black{
	font-size: 10px;
	font-style: normal;
	color: #000000;
	font-weight: normal;
	margin-top: 5px;
	margin-bottom: 5px
    }
.px10_gray{
	font-size: 10px;
	font-style: normal;
	color: #666666;
	font-weight: normal;
	margin-top: 5px;
	margin-bottom: 5px
    }
.px16_brde{
	font-size: 16px;
	font-style: normal;
	color: #FF0000;
	font-weight: normal
}

.px10_brde{
	font-size: 10px;
	font-style: normal;
	color: #FF0000;
	font-weight: normal;
	line-height:1.3em;
}

.px10_a{
    color:#009900;
	font-size: 10px;
	font-style: normal;
}

.px16_a{
    color:#009900;
	font-size: 16px;
	font-style: normal;
}
	


/*　お友達を紹介するのCSSなのね　*/
.px12_friend{
	font-size: 12px;
	font-style: normal;
	text-align: center;
	color: #000000;
	width: 300px;
	font-weight: normal;
　　background-color: #FFCC33;
　　margin-top: 15px;
	margin-bottom: 15px;
    padding-top : 3px;
	padding-bottom: 3px
}

.px10_friend{
	font-size: 10px;
	font-style: normal;
	text-align: center;
	color: #555555;
	width: 300px;
	font-weight: normal;
　　background-color: #FFCC33;
　　margin-top: 10px;
	margin-bottom: 10px;
    padding-top : 3px;
	padding-bottom: 3px
}

/*　Q&A用のCSSです。　*/
.px12_qanda{
	font-size:12px;
	font-style:normal;
	color:#555555;
	border-left:solid 10px #FFCC33;
	background-color:#FFFF99;
　　padding-left : 5px;
    width :600px
}

.px12_q{
	font-size: 12px;
	font-style: normal;
	color: #555555;
	line-height: 1.5em;
    }


/*　ショッピング用のCSSです。　*/
.px10_shop{
	font-size: 10px;
	font-style: normal;
	color: #333333;
	font-weight: normal;
	line-height:1.3em;
	}
.px12_blueshop{
	font-size: 12px;
	font-style: normal;
	color: #00990A;
	font-weight: normal;
    line-height:1.3em;
}

.px12_brde_shop{
	font-size: 12px;
	font-style: normal;
	color: #FF3300;
	font-weight: normal;
　　line-height:1.3em;
}

/*　コンセプト用のCSSです。　*/
.px12_graycon{
	font-size: 12px;
	font-style: normal;
	color: #666666;
	font-weight: normal;
	line-height:1.5em;
}

.px14_oracon{
	font-size: 14px;
	font-style: normal;
	color: #FF9933;
	font-weight: normal;
}

.px14_red{
	font-size: 14px;
	font-style: normal;
	color: #FF0000;
	font-weight: normal;
}

.px12_oracon{
	font-size: 12px;
	font-style: normal;
	color: #FF9933;
	font-weight: normal;
	line-height:1.3em;
}
/*　全商品用のCSSです。　*/
.px10_bold_products{
	font-size: 10px;
	font-style: normal;
	color: #666666;
	font-weight: normal;
    border-top:solid 1.5px #FFCC33;
	border-bottom:solid 1.5px #FFCC33;
	border-right:solid 1.5px #FFCC33;
	border-left:solid 1.5px #FFCC33;
	padding-left : 10px;
	padding-right: 10px;
	padding-top : 5px;
	padding-bottom: 5px;
	line-height:1.3em
	}

.px12_graypro{
	font-size: 12px;
	font-style: normal;
	color: #666666;
	font-weight: normal;
	line-height:1.5em;
}

.px12_orapro{
	font-size: 12px;
	font-style: normal;
	color: #FF9900;
	font-weight: normal;
	line-height:1.5em;
}
.px12_graypro2{
	font-size: 12px;
	font-style: normal;
	color: #666666;
	font-weight: normal;
	line-height:1.5em;
}

img.right{
float: right;
margin-left: 0.8em;
margin-bottom: 0.5em;
vertical-align:bottom
}


.link12px_qa{
	font-size: 12px;
	font-style: normal;
	color: #FF9900;
	padding: 5px;
	text-decoration:none;
	font-weight: normal
}

.link12px_qa:hover{
	font-size: 12px;
	font-style: normal;
	color: #FFCC66;
	padding: 5px;
	text-decoration:none;
	font-weight: normal
	}




